CLEMMONS v. STATE

A93A1590.

210 Ga. App. 632 (1993)

437 S.E.2d 350

CLEMMONS v. THE STATE.

Court of Appeals of Georgia.

Decided October 21, 1993.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Johnny B. Mostiler, for appellant.

Johnnie L. Caldwell, Jr., District Attorney, Daniel A. Hiatt, William T. McBroom III, Assistant District Attorneys, for appellee.


JOHNSON, Judge.

Hartford Clemmons appeals from his convictions of rape, aggravated assault, false imprisonment and possession of a firearm during the commission of a felony. The trial court, pursuant to Clemmons' request, appointed counsel to represent Clemmons on appeal. His appointed attorney has filed enumerations of error and a brief.
